Geography comments: Bolomor Cave is situated on the "southern slope of the Valldigna valley, approximately 2 km southeast of the town of Tavernes"
The coordinates entered are based on Tavernes de la Valldigna as that was the closest possible estimate
"The karst deposit of Bolomor Cave has been dated by Amino Acid Racemization (AR) and Thermoluminescence (TL) to between MIS 9 and MIS 5"
Level XVII has been dated to 0.525 Ma +/- 0.125 Ma using "Amino Acid Racemization"

Habitat comments: "Bolomor cave is a karst cavity opened to the exterior approximately 500 ka, as a consequence of the erosion of the ravine where is placed"
"The sedimentary sequence of Bolomor Cave consists mainly of allochthonous material of colluvial origin. In addition to these deposits, there are other autochthonous sediments of gravitational origin from the roof subsidence, due to tectonics or weathering processes."
Level XVII is divided into three morphological and sedimentological sub-levels (XVIIa, XVIIb, XVIIc)
Level XVIIc is the most ancient level at Bolomor Cave
Anthropogenic cut marks are observed mainly on the long bones of medium-large animals but also appear on lagomorphs, as well as on two Aves bones
Carnivore damage is present on 29 ungulate remains
"The human consumption of small prey seems to be habitual among hominids that inhabited Bolomor Cave from the earliest moments. Therefore, it is possible to support a certain anthropic recurrence to these animals throughout the sedimentary sequence"
